CHI Health Saint Francis has been dedicating its treatment programs and services to helping individuals who are struggling with alcohol and drug addiction in Henderson and within the surrounding area.
CHI Health Saint Francis offers a wide range of treatment and rehabilitation programs, including inpatient drug rehab facilities, long term addiction treatment facilities, detoxification centers, outpatient counseling, short term rehab centers and more. CHI Health Saint Francis also believes that it is important that it presents individual services to ensure that individuals get the results that they want. This is why CHI Health Saint Francis is specialized in vocational rehabilitation services, brief intervention approach, relapse prevention, dual diagnosis drug rehab, activity therapy, matrix model, among other programs.
CHI Health Saint Francis also provides seniors or older adults, persons with serious mental illness, domestic violence, active duty military, persons who have experienced sexual abuse, co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ders, and offers some of the best continued recovery programs - all of which are necessary and helpful to its clients. This substance abuse treatment facility also uses treatment methods that can help you achieve full stability both in the long term and permanently.
CHI Health Saint Francis also accepts the following forms of payment - private medical insurance, cash or self-payment, payment assistance, medicare, medicaid, county or local government funds, state welfare or child and family services funds and more.
